Carlos Alcaraz produced a confident display to reach the US Open quarterfinals. The Spaniard controlled the match from start to finish, showing the rhythm and sharpness that define his game.
He dictated the pace with powerful groundstrokes and clever variety, keeping Arthur Rinderknech on the defensive. Alcaraz stayed aggressive, mixing attack and defense with ease. His consistency earned him a straight-sets victory and a place in the last eight.
After the match, Alcaraz said he felt in “good rhythm” and happy with his level. The win gave him extra confidence heading into the tougher stages of the tournament.
With energy, composure, and raw talent, Alcaraz continues to prove he is one of the top contenders for the title.
